Job description

About the role:

Are you a strategic fundraising leader with a passion for building meaningful donor relationships and driving philanthropic impact? Imperial College London is seeking an exceptional individual to lead our Regular Giving and Legacy Giving programmes as we prepare for an ambitious new campaign.

What you would be doing:

As Head of Regular Giving and Legacy Giving, you will shape and deliver sector-leading programmes that inspire gifts up to £50,000 and legacy contributions from alumni and supporters. You’ll lead a talented team and oversee multi-channel fundraising campaigns, donor journeys, and stewardship initiatives that support Imperial’s world-class research and education.

You’ll play a pivotal role in:

  • Developing and executing innovative fundraising strategies.
  • Growing donor acquisition, retention, and income.
  • Leading a high-performing team and fostering a culture of excellence.
  • Collaborating across Advancement and the wider College to embed giving into the Imperial experience.
  • Managing a portfolio of mid-level donors and legacy pledgers.

What we are looking for:

We’re seeking a dynamic and experienced fundraising professional who brings:

  • A strong track record in mass fundraising, digital campaigns, and donor stewardship.
  • Experience managing successful legacy giving programmes.
  • Strategic thinking and data-driven decision-making.
  • Excellent leadership and interpersonal skills.
  • A passion for higher education and making a lasting impact.

What we can offer you:

At Imperial, you’ll be part of a vibrant, inclusive community at the forefront of science, technology, and innovation. You’ll have the opportunity to shape the future of philanthropy at one of the world’s leading universities, with access to professional development, flexible working, and a supportive team environment.

Further Information

This is a full-time, open ended role based at White City Campus.
